Project Accountant Construction (New Rochelle, NY)
Salary: ~$125,000 (open depending on experience) | Full-Time | On-Site
A well-established construction company in New Rochelle, NY is seeking an experienced Project Accountant to support financial oversight across multiple active projects. This role is fully in-office, Monday through Friday, and requires a professional who is comfortable working closely with project teams, operations, and senior finance leadership.
Position Overview
The Project Accountant will be responsible for tracking project costs, analyzing financial performance, preparing reports, and supporting project managers with budgeting, forecasting, and billing. This position plays a critical role in ensuring accurate financial reporting and supporting decision-making for both current and future projects.
Key Responsibilities
- Track and analyze project costs including labor, materials, subcontractors, equipment, and other job-related expenses
- Prepare and maintain project budgets in collaboration with Project Managers
- Analyze budget variances and prepare cost-to-complete estimates
- Prepare monthly forecasts, cash flow projections, and revenue projections
- Generate monthly operating and financial reports for management review
- Assist Project Managers with progress billing, change orders, and subcontractor documentation
- Review internal equipment billings and ensure proper allocation to projects
- Support the Regional Controller with forecasting, business planning, and financial analysis
- Prepare ad hoc financial reports and analysis as requested
- Ensure compliance with accounting policies, internal controls, and financial procedures
Required Qualifications
- 5+ years of construction accounting experience (any construction sector acceptable)
- Bachelor's degree in Accounting or Finance; CPA is a plus but not required
- Strong understanding of job cost accounting and construction financial principles
- Experience with percentage-of-completion accounting preferred
- Ability to analyze financial data and prepare accurate reports and projections
- Strong communication skills and ability to work closely with project teams
- High level of professionalism, discretion, and integrity
- Proficiency with accounting/ERP systems; experience with JDE is a plus
- Advanced Excel skills and strong overall computer proficiency
